To make a question in English we normally use Do or Does It is normally put at the beginning of the question (before the subject) Affirmative: You speak Spanish Question: Do you speak Spanish? You will see that we add DO at the beginning of the affirmative sentence to make it a question We use Do when the subject is I, you, we or they
